Fighting Hunger to Strengthen our Community
Currently, The SC3 International Family of Companies is working with the Rio Grande Food Project to support the growing need for hungry families. The Rio Grande Food Project provides emergency food relief to hungry individuals and families throughout the Albuquerque, NM Metro area. They are the second largest food pantry in the city and have been filling empty bellies since 1989. Last year, RGFP had a 40% increase and provided 665,000 meals to 40,730 hungry children, adults and seniors. Each $1 donated purchases $3 of food. Supporting Albuquerque Christian Children’s Home
For more than 40 years, ACCH has provided care for children in need. A dream was realized in 1969 to house, clothe, and educate at-risk children in crisis. When Joel and Nina Taylor, ranchers in the Albuquerque area, were introduced to A.F. Cole, a construction contractor in the Albuquerque area, the dream began to materialize.
Since receiving the first children in 1970, Albuquerque Christian Children’s Home has cared for hundreds of children. Up to eighteen children receive care at any given time. The purpose of the home is to nurture, guide, and inspire children to be honest, have a healthy self-image, and to put God first in their lives. The goals of the home are to heal past hurts, and to help the children grow to become responsible citizens of their community, hold fulfilling jobs, and care for their fellow man.
